The bachelor's program at University of Rio Grande was ranked #459 on College Factual's Best Schools for health science list.

University of Rio Grande Health Sciences & Services Associate’s Program

All of the 7 students who graduated with a Associate’s in health science from University of Rio Grande in 2021 were women.

undefined

The majority of the students with this major are white. About 57% of 2021 graduates were in this category.
